Calsol 2 Pro Grease

possess excellent high temperature and water tolerance characteristics which makes this grease the
ultimate choice for severe applications. Due to its inherent EP property, this grease exhibits great stability in the presence of water, allowing a balance between wear protection and resistance to corrosion.
Calcium Sulfonate complex greases are an excellent alternative to conventional greases for consistent
performance in harsh operating conditions. With very high water resistance and improved extreme pressure characteristics, these greases are excellent choices for most demanding applications like steel mill, paper, and pulp machineries.
Features/Benefits:
- Exceptional water tolerance ensures continued lubrication even in presence of heavy water contamination.
- Outstanding high temperature resistance prevents grease from oil bleeding, helps maintain its structure for prolonged time.
- High mechanical and shear stability provides extended re-greasing intervals, reduces overall consumption, and improves cost savings.
- Excellent load carrying capacity protects equipment from heavy and shock loads, reduces break down and improves operating profit.
Application:
- Steel mill applications like ladle turret bearings, continuous caster, work roll bearings, roll neck, Coiler mandrel etc.
- Wet end, grinding and pulper, press etc. in paper and pulp industry.
- Vibrating screens of asphalt hot mix plant.
- Marine and offshore applications.
- Automotive, agricultural, construction, cement and mining industry machinery.
- Applications requiring resistance to high load and humid environment.
- Operating temperature range -20°C to +180°C.
- Can be used above 180°C with increased re-greasing interval. Regreasing interval to be
determined by the user.
Typical Properties:
| Properties | Test Method | Calsol 2 Pro Grease |
|---|---|---|
| NLGI Grade | 2 | |
| Soap / Thickener type | Calcium Sulfonate complex | |
| Appearance | Visual | Smooth, tacky |
| Color | Visual | Brown |
| Worked penetration @25°C, 60 double strokes | ASTM D217 | 285 |
| Penetration 100,000 double strokes | ASTM D217 | 300 |
| Drop point, °C | ASTM D2265 | 300 |
| Base oil properties- | ||
| a. Kinematic Viscosity @ 40°C, cSt | ASTM D445 | 460 |
| b. Kinematic Viscosity @ 100°C, cSt | ASTM D445 | 30 |
| Copper strip corrosion at 100°C for 24 hrs. | ASTM D4048 | Negative |
| Water washout @80°C, % mass | ASTM D1264 | 0.8 |
| Oxidation Stability, 100hr@ 99°C, kPa | ASTM D942 | 10.3 |
| Water washout @80°C, % mass | ASTM D2596 | 620 |
| Four Ball Wear Scar, mm | ASTM D2266 | 0.40 |
| Emcor rust test, rating | IP220 | 0,0 |
The above typical properties are those obtained with normal production tolerance and do not constitute a specification. Variations that do not affect product performance are to be expected during normal manufacture and at different blending locations.
